Dr. Daniel Ho

    Dr. Daniel Ho is a technologist specialising in the development of technology solutions for Defence’s needs. Daniel’s technical training lies in corrosion prevention and previously worked in Exxon-Mobil as a Materials Engineer managing the Altona Refinery’s pipeline assets. He has also conducted research in the area of life extension of military aircraft. He is a co-inventor on a Patent for an environmentally friendly corrosion inhibitor compound as well as authored and co-authored a number of published journal papers.
